GUESS WHO !<br />
The clever pen of Napier Dunn in the Mainichi<br />
Daily News recently caught this 'profile' - easily<br />
recognizable as that of Mr E.M. van Rhoon, RIL's<br />
Manager for Japan who has just celebrated 25 years<br />
of service (see page 49) . We understand that he<br />
was presented with the framed original drawing on<br />
6th January.<br />

KIWI FAREWELL<br />
Last month. in his description of Tjiluwah's cruise<br />
to New Zealand, Captain M aan described a 'lone<br />
piper in full Scottish regalia' who played his bagpipes<br />
standing on a 20' high platform off Goat <strong>Is</strong>land<br />
as the ship left Dunedin.<br />
This lonely last farewell caused something of a<br />
sensation to passengers. amongst whom was Mr<br />
W. Abadee (Sydney) . He took this photograph in<br />
the evening light, and sharp eyes can just see the<br />
piper standing near the light beacon.<br />
" Will ye no' come back again?"
